Commercial Slab Construction in Grand Junction, CO
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of solid, durable concrete foundations for various types of commercial properties. This includes projects such as retail stores, office buildings, warehouses, and industrial facilities. Property owners typically seek this service to ensure a stable base for their structures, which is essential for safety, longevity, and proper load-bearing capacity. Before requesting slab construction, it is important to understand the specific requirements of the project, including size, load expectations, and site conditions, to ensure the foundation is designed appropriately.
Property owners should also consider factors like soil stability, drainage, and local building codes when planning for commercial slab construction. Clear communication about project scope, timeline, and any site-specific challenges can help facilitate a smooth process. Proper planning and preparation are key to achieving a foundation that supports the intended use of the property and meets all necessary standards.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are often used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and storage facilities on property sites.
What are the benefits of a concrete slab for commercial properties? A concrete slab provides a durable, stable surface that supports heavy loads and minimizes maintenance needs over time.
How is a commercial slab constructed? Construction involves site preparation, setting formwork, reinforcing with steel, and pouring concrete to create a solid, level surface.
What factors influence the choice of slab thickness? The intended use, load requirements, and soil conditions help determine the appropriate thickness for a commercial slab.
